Enterprise Architect – 6-Month Contract

Location: Stoke-based
Working Pattern: 2–3 days onsite per week
Duration: 6 months
Day Rate: Open

We are looking for an experienced Enterprise Architect to support a major transformation programme, developing the target architecture and transition roadmap using a TOGAF-aligned approach.

The role will also support the RFP process, providing evidence-based architectural recommendations to help evaluate technology options, suppliers and the future technology ecosystem.

Key Responsibilities

  • Develop the target-state Enterprise Architecture and transition roadmap.
  • Support the RFP process, including technology options and supplier evaluation.
  • Review and validate existing architecture and discovery outputs.
  • Confirm application, integration, data and technology dependencies.
  • Identify architectural gaps, risks and opportunities.
  • Assess integration and migration implications.
  • Provide clear, evidence-based recommendations to senior stakeholders.
  • Participate in Architecture Review Board and existing governance processes.
  • Work closely with the Head of Digital, Architecture & Governance and internal Solution Architect.

About You

You will have:

  • Proven experience as an Enterprise Architect within complex transformation programmes.
  • Strong knowledge of TOGAF or similar architecture frameworks.
  • Experience developing target architectures and transition roadmaps.
  • Strong application, integration, data and technology architecture experience.
  • Experience supporting RFPs, supplier selection and technology evaluations.
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ills.
  • The ability to translate complex architecture into clear, commercially relevant recommendations.
